Transaction 51af7e1003a4bbda6bcefd701bb5f9d8f2ccff75fd9901325535d2434f672518

1 Input
2 Outputs
  • 51af7e1003a4bbda6bcefd701bb5f9d8f2ccff75fd9901325535d2434f672518:0
  • value  2549714043
    address  3HCufpyqXEtHjbdMU9RMWBXzupr4VRUPMR
  • 51af7e1003a4bbda6bcefd701bb5f9d8f2ccff75fd9901325535d2434f672518:1
  • value  1000000
    address  1QDhHw4VJxEiyXogKuoPbE2yukTyUtRvZT